In The News Posted April 10, 2016 Share Posted April 10, 2016 Michel Gordillo, of Spain, was scheduled to talk at Sun 'n Fun this week about his adventures flying an RV-8 around the world, via both North and South Poles -- but the intrepid pilot's plans were derailed by border-crossing bureaucracy. Gordillo's team said that when he arrived at the Mexico/U.S. border, Gordillo did as he was told -- he crossed the border in Texas on foot to get his passport stamped, then returned to Mexico to his airplane.
